4. Getting Started (Setup)

4.1. Charging the Tablet

Before first use, fully charge the tablet using the provided charger and charging cable. Connect the Type-C cable to the tablet's Type-C port and the charger to a power outlet. The battery indicator on the screen will show charging status.

4.2. Powering On/Off

  • To Power On: Press and hold the Power ON/OFF button until the YOTOPT logo appears.
  • To Power Off: Press and hold the Power ON/OFF button, then select "Power off" from the options on the screen.
  • To Sleep/Wake: Briefly press the Power ON/OFF button.

4.3. Initial Setup

Upon first power-on, follow the on-screen prompts to complete the initial setup:

  1. Select your preferred language.
  2. Connect to a Wi-Fi network.
  3. Sign in with your Google account or create a new one.
  4. Review and accept the terms and conditions.

4.4. Inserting a Micro SD Card

To expand storage, insert a Micro SD (TF) card into the designated slot. Ensure the tablet is powered off before inserting or removing the card to prevent data corruption.

8. Troubleshooting

8.1. Tablet Does Not Turn On

  • Ensure the battery is charged. Connect the charger and wait a few minutes before attempting to power on.
  • Press and hold the Power ON/OFF button for 10-15 seconds to perform a force restart.
  • If unresponsive, use a thin pin to press the Reset pinhole.

8.2. Wi-Fi Connection Issues

  • Ensure Wi-Fi is enabled in Settings.
  • Restart your Wi-Fi router.
  • Forget the network in tablet settings and reconnect.

8.3. Slow Performance

  • Close unused applications.
  • Clear cache for apps in Settings > Apps.
  • Ensure sufficient storage space is available.
  • Restart the tablet.

9. Specifications

FeatureSpecification
BrandYOTOPT
Model NumberT28-EEA
SeriesK110W
Operating SystemAndroid 12
Processor BrandUnisoc
Number of Cores8
RAM11 GB (4GB installed + 7GB virtual)
Storage (ROM)64 GB
Expandable StorageUp to 1 TB via Micro SD/TF card
Screen Size10.1 Inches
Screen Resolution1280 x 800 pixels (FHD IPS)
Max Display Resolution1080 Pixels
Front Camera5 MP
Rear Camera8 MP
ConnectivityBluetooth, USB, WLAN (802.11ac, 802.11g, 802.11n)
Interface3.5mm Audio, Bluetooth, Micro SD, USB Type-C
Battery Capacity8000 mAh (Lithium-polymer)
Dimensions (L x W x H)23.01 x 16 x 0.79 cm
Weight490 Grams
Special FeaturesUSB OTG Support, Eye Protection Mode, Dark Mode
